Woman assaults police officer in Gulfport Wal-Mart

GULFPORT, Miss. (AP) – Police say a woman accused of shoplifting at the Super Wal-Mart in Gulfport ran back into the store to avoid arrest and punched, pushed and scratched a police officer.

Sgt. Damon McDaniel said in a news release the officer was assaulted Monday in a confrontation near the self-checkout area.

McDaniel said 19-year-old Lamyrica Holder, of Gulfport, faces a felony charge of simple assault on a law enforcement officer.

He says the officer was treated for minor injuries.

Holder is being held in the Harrison County jail on a $20,000 bond.

Online jail records do not list an attorney for her.
